Hundreds are expected to gather along Tokyo’s Arakawa River on Saturday to commemorate an oft-forgotten massacre. Following the Great Kanto earthquake on Sept. 1, 1923, Japanese authorities spread rumors that immigrants from Korea – then a colony of Japan – were starting riots and poisoning city wells.
